Shrill by Lindy West
5.0

A fast and highly enjoyable read. I imagine this book gets shelved along side Roxane Gay's "Bad Feminist", with which it pairs well. Like that collection, West's book contains sections which can stand alone as individual essays, but which also build on each other to tell a partial story of the author's life. I was a little less interested in the first four chapters about her life before college, which felt less fully realized than the later pieces. But from page 5o onwards I was absolutely hooked and I read nearly the whole rest of the book in one sitting. West is a hell of a writer, and she has had some experiences which would have scarred me for life. Just reading about them made my hair stand on end. I left the book with a feeling of deep admiration, and I plan to read more of her work in the future.
